Output 069580ae1d62952f86d0b93a378aecaa341869b8ec93e08ad288bbd01b230450:26

value
1683019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93587b70075f7be0abb840be59c9bfd194d7900e OP_EQUAL
address
3F87FbJu6EeqZxjG8qHxHQYEgTJRetP9pk
transaction
069580ae1d62952f86d0b93a378aecaa341869b8ec93e08ad288bbd01b230450
spent
true